> Did one of you epia fellows yet run nvram-wakeup successfully?
I am using Debian sarge with the packages from
http://www.e-tobi.net/vdr_repositories.html on an Epia MII Nehemiah
6000 in a Rebach box. nvram-wakeup worked out of the box after I set
the wakeup time in BIOS to a correct time once.
